Glioblastoma and anaplastic astrocytoma are two of the most common form of brain tumours in adults.

Too often they can be life changing, even life limiting for patients, wreaking devastation on their families.

This readable, moving and non technical guide is your comprehensive patient focussed guide to these obstinate brain cancers.

It covers everything from getting an accurate diagnosis, to dealing with the physical, mental and emotional impact of the disease. From treatment options and how to cope with their side effects, to newly developing techniques and future research.

This book presents an honest and realistic picture, with a personal approach. Featuring dozens of personal testimonies from those with these high grade brain tumours and their loved ones, the book offers information, reassurance and support on these, the most complex of brain tumours.

In this patient centred book, you will discover everything you might like to know:

About these brain tumours;

Detecting brain tumours;

Diagnosis;

Treatment;

Changes and challenges;

Family and friends reaction;

Prognosis;

Dealing with death;

Trials and research.
